Neurodiversity and Mental Health

 

This Masterclass will focus on lifestyle changes that can improve mental health. We will consider the overlap with autism and other neurodiverse conditions. The objective is to focus on some basic issues and begin to formulate a plan for progress.

Bowen Health Masterclass Instructor
Bil Easley

Bil is the Autism Program Manager at Bowen Health, he is a Master Instructor for the Crisis Prevention Institute, and he is a gifted instructor.  

Bil’s career started as a schoolteacher. When his son, Luke, was born 34 years ago, Bil’s world changed. Luke has severe autism. Since that time Bil has studied autism and helped children, adults and their families navigate neurodiversity. His work managing behavior on the front lines and his study of autism and other disorders has led to work in the field of nutrition and other environmental and lifestyle factors that impact behavior for everyone.
